The study of multiple classifier systems has become an area of intensive research in pattern recognition recently. Also in handwriting recognition, systems combining several classifiers have been investigated. In this paper the combination of three classifiers for handwritten word recognition with different architectures is studied. In addition a new ensemble method working with several base classifiers is applied and the results of the ensemble method are compared to the results of the combination of the three classifiers. In the experiments a large scale handwritten word recognition task is considered.
